Output 11d87acacbb05b4f021e48946cf14f38bc15a71fdef90601a9d99583adee8d56:3

value
28766815
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 974349310f26b263bcecfb44acb8dce6ca930fd0664d6ec0f1b4ff66003b976a
address
tb1pjap5jvg0y6ex808vldz2ewxuum9fxr7svexkas83knlkvqpmja4qgvnt3j
transaction
11d87acacbb05b4f021e48946cf14f38bc15a71fdef90601a9d99583adee8d56
confirmations
29641
spent
true